Output 1ad695198dc502e8fec95420ed616092f6875189f38a754a8505190534418e23:10

value
8653792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9d020ca5fe2225a8ebe96e2413bc952de9567f4 OP_EQUAL
address
MPP3kqpmB6Ltk4bzHGvweUzie46cnMHqcg
transaction
1ad695198dc502e8fec95420ed616092f6875189f38a754a8505190534418e23
spent
true